CLAT exam is just round the corner and now is the ideal time to practice solving as many mock tests for CLAT as one can possible get their hands on. Apart from that, candidates are also advised to practice some sample papers for CLAT 2017 so that they know what to expect in the exam that is scheduled to be held on May 14.

The CLAT exam has questions from five broad subjects, that is, Legal Aptitude, Logical Reasoning, English, Elementary Mathematics as well as General Knowledge & Current Affairs.

It has been shared that more than 45,000 registrations have been received for the exam and so aspirants are advised to practice as many questions as possible so that they can fare well in this CLAT 2017.

We advise that it would be better if candidates try to solve previous years’ CLAT question papers because such an initiative will help them develop a better understanding of what to expect in the exam this year.
